Common Anti-Patterns
Anti-Pattern
Fix
No tool restrictions
Add tools allowlist
Vague description
Write specific trigger conditions
Giant system prompt
Keep concise, use skills for detail
Recursive subagents
Restrict Task in tools
Windows long prompts (>8191 chars)
Use file-based agents, not --agents CLI
Context Passing
Agent receives ONLY its system prompt + task prompt — NOT parent conversation
Parent receives ONLY agent's final result — NOT intermediate tool calls
This isolation is the primary context management benefit

AI Mistake Prevention — Failure modes to avoid on every task:
Re-read files after context changes. Context compaction, resume, or long-running work can make memory stale; verify current files before acting.
Verify generated content against source evidence. AI hallucinates APIs, names, claims, and document facts. Check the relevant source before documenting or referencing.
Check downstream references before deleting or renaming. Removing an artifact can stale docs, generated mirrors, configs, and callers; map references first.
Trace the full impact chain after edits. Changing a definition can miss derived outputs and consumers. Follow the affected chain before declaring done.
Verify ALL affected outputs, not just the first. One green check is not all green checks; validate every output surface the change can affect.
Assume existing values are intentional — ask WHY before changing. Before changing a constant, limit, flag, wording, or pattern, read nearby context and history.
Surface ambiguity before acting — don't pick silently. Multiple valid interpretations require an explicit question or stated assumption with risk.
Keep shared guidance role-relevant. Universal guidance must help every receiving skill or agent; code-specific obligations belong only in code-specific protocols.
